Section 1: What is Chime Bank?
Think of Chime Bank as your friendly neighborhood bank—but online! It’s a financial technology company that offers basic banking services without the hassle of traditional banks. Here’s what you need to know:
- No Minimum Balance: No need to worry about keeping a certain amount of money in your account. Chime believes you should keep what you earn!
- No Monthly Fees: Say goodbye to the annoying fees that some banks charge. With Chime, you can save money without extra costs.
Section 2: Features That Stand Out
So, what makes Chime special? Here are some features that could really benefit you:
- Early Direct Deposit: With Chime, if you set up direct deposit (that’s when your paycheck goes directly into your bank account), you can get your money up to two days early. Imagine having your funds available before the weekend!
- Round-Up Savings: This feature helps you save more effortlessly. Chime rounds up your purchases to the nearest dollar and puts the spare change into a separate savings account. Over time, those small amounts can really add up!
- Budgeting Tools: Chime provides simple tools that give you an overview of your income and spending habits, making it easier to budget for bills and fun stuff.
Section 3: Safety and Security
One common concern about online banking is safety. Here’s how Chime keeps your money secure:
- FDIC Insurance: Your deposits are insured up to $250,000 by the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C), so your money is covered.
- 24/7 Account Monitoring: Chime keeps an eye on your account around the clock. If any suspicious activity occurs, they’ll alert you quickly.
Section 4: Limitations to Consider
Before you jump in, let’s look at a few things you should keep in mind:
- Limited Services: While Chime offers essential banking services, it doesn’t provide everything a traditional bank might, like physical branches.
- ATM Withdrawal Fees: While you have access to a network of free ATMs, using out-of-network ATMs can lead to fees, so be aware of where you’re withdrawing cash.
